Montrose Road,Ochil View Postcode

Montrose Road,Ochil View < Strathallan < Perth and Kinross < Scotland < Scotland < United Kingdom

Explore Montrose Road,Ochil View Postal Codes

Montrose Road,Ochil View is a locality in United Kingdom.
There are 1 postal codes in Montrose Road,Ochil View.

Postal Codes for Montrose Road,Ochil View:

  • PH3 1FF Montrose Road,Ochil View
    Strathallan, Perth and Kinross, Scotland, Scotland GPS: 56.294589, -3.698174
Back to top button